The Angel Hotel
10/10 Excellent
"We only spent one night but loved the hotel. The location is great. Plenty of bars, restaurants and shops a few minutes walk away and a beautiful park opposite. The rooms were very clean and spacious. Staff were very welcoming and helpful. Lots of seating in the lounge. On arrival by car, you hand over your key and your car is parked and luggage delivered to your room which is a nice touch. Would highly recommend"
